Judge Drops Murder Charges For AR Sheriff Nominee Who Admitted Killing Daughter’s Accused Rapist
What a remarkable turn of events, just weeks before an explosive trial was set to begin in Arkansas. A judge has dismissed second degree murder charges against the leading candidate for Lonoke County Sheriff., 37-year-old Aaron Spencer. Spencer was in pursuit of 67-year-old Michael Fosler, who kidnapped his 13-year-old daughter while out on parole for allegedly sexually assaulting her months earlier. Spencer admits to running him off the road, shooting and killing Fosler and rescuing his daughter in the process. 40 Years After Her Rape And Murder, Justice For Roberta Walls
Police have arrested a former Navy cadet who has been married for 4 decades, for the 1986 rape and murder of 22-year-old Roberta Walls. 66-year-old Charles Berry is now in custody, after police finally linked DNA from the crime scene to a genealogy website that confirmed Berry as the killer. Prisoner Released Early, Helped Fight Wildfires: Now 5 Women Are Dead
41-year-old Jesse Calhoun was in court yesterday, arraigned on a fifth homicide in a string of murders that terrorized the Portland, Oregon community. Family members of some of the young victims, who all ranged in age from 22 to 32, were present as Calhoun pleaded not guilty. Calhoun has a long criminal history of violent crime, but was released early under a prison firefighting program. Trump Got Him Out Of Prison, Now Ex Congressman Makes Bid To Go Back: You Won’t Believe Why
The Department of Justice has opened a new investigation into former New York Republican Congressman George Santos. President Trump commuted his 7 year sentence for financial crimes, but now he’s being investigated for insider trading. Officials say Santos bet against himself attending Trump’s SOTU address, after telling his X followers he was going. By NOT going, he was then able to cash in tens of thousands of dollars with his bet. See omnystudio.com/listener for privacy information.

Murder Trial Begins For 17-Year-Old Accused Of Stabbing Fellow Teen At High School Track Meet
Jury selection is underway for 17-year-old Karmelo Anthony who is facing life in prison for the stabbing death of 17-year-old Austin Metcalf at a track meet in Texas last year. Extra security is in place at the courthouse and there is a strict electronic gag for members of the media given all the racial tensions that have erupted in the aftermath of the murder. Anthony is black, Metcalf was white, and a significant amount of misinformation has circulated online that resulted in death threats for both the victim’s and the defendant’s families over the past several months. 953
California “Party Mom” Gets 35 Years In Prison
A judge gave 52-year-old Shannon O’Connor the maximum sentence possible after the California mom was found guilty of more than 4 dozen felony counts. O’Connor cried openly in court as victims and their parents stepped forward to describe the lasting trauma she caused for plying teens with drinks and egging on non-consensual sex in her home. O’Connor claims she held alcohol fueled parties to help her 15-year-old son’s social life, but prosecutors say she is now a sexual predator, convicted felon and a registered sex offender.
